Thousands of BBC Radio 2 listeners tune in each morning to hear Sarah Kennedy's honeyed voice drift across the ether for the Dawn Patrol. Here, Sarah now brings us 'Brief Encounters', a collection of letters and emails about real people's brushes with fame.

From the grandson of Dr Crippen's cleaner and the little girl who told Al Jolson that he couldn't sing, to the eager punter who knocked over the Queen Mother while rushing to place a bet and the shop assistant who sold anti-wrinkle cream to Gerry Marsden. Don't miss this enchanting collection selected by "Bunty" herself and illustrated with hilarious cartoons.
